TG 3.1 Teaser Release Date
Well, I've been recruiting and pushing the dev team on the 3.1 update. I haven't posted much about it because I honestly didn't know what was going into it or when it would come out. We're working hard to putting together a teaser to show you what will be in one of the last updates to our community mod.
List of Features- Weapon stats adjustments
- Scriptable objects
- Of course we need missions to show off those objects!
- A couple new weapons and items
- New weapon sounds
Scriptable objects include crates, a tower and other various goodies to spice up missions. The tower does allow scripters to place actors in them. I won't mention all the objects in the list for the teaser because some will really surprise you. Once you play the new missions, you'll be blown away at the cool improvements!
New weapons include the return of the M79 and the Walther P99. The M79 will replace the MM1 in some MOUT kits and be coupled with the MP5SD for a new combination. It will be employing timed grenades instead of exploding on impact. The P99 will be paired with the WA2000 for some Bond action. Along with the MP5 10mm's new stats will be a suppressed version. There will be a new Porta-Bush item for snipers. The final will have various bush types. This teaser will showcase the tall grass type that is found on most original GR maps.
Some weapon sounds have been replaced. They'll change again for the 3.1 final if you guys don't like them very much. The M60 will have a different sound from the one that came with Frostbite. The M16 will have a different sound as I found the original to sound nothing like it's real life counterpart. The same goes for the Aug as it's been using the M4 sound for too long.
For the final and subsequent updates, there will be much more of everything posted here. We're hoping to release some maps before GR2 comes out. We'll be focusing on CQB since the loss of the SOAF maps due to legal limitations. I also hope there will be more of us scripting missions. The main goal of 3.1 is to provide tools for the community to easily script cool missions using the same maps we've been playing on for nearly 3 years.

There's a change with the SVU. I've put the scope zoom back to the original of 10. It's also the SVU-A now, the A designates automatic fire (half the firing rate of most assualt rifles). It'll be somewhat useful in CQB situations, meaning until the 10-round mag runs out.
The 'demolitions' class is now the 'engineer' class. The demo charges have been renamed to 'Tool Kit'. This is a cosmetic change only. They still function as demo charges but it allows mission scripters to do objectives where specialists must be the one performing the action such as repairing a vehicle by using (placing) a tool kit (demo charge).

TG 3.1 Teaser - 15Mb
Here's the release of the teaser mod. It's up on the Mod Server. Unzip it into your GR mods directory and activate it in game. It's a good idea to deactivate all other mods. Frostbite is not required for this. The grid overlays were not included to minimize the file size. You can copy the grids over from the TG 3.0 mod over to the 3.1 teaser or over the original overlays.
